Transaction 91e1f0d63f57e43f797659735200c57491b08e3a5aa8e120bc01973b2e7920a3

1 Input
2 Outputs
  • 91e1f0d63f57e43f797659735200c57491b08e3a5aa8e120bc01973b2e7920a3:0
  • value  20896775
    address  3D5moLdVqpumCy4y99ckx3HCVqrv2YVZ3t
  • 91e1f0d63f57e43f797659735200c57491b08e3a5aa8e120bc01973b2e7920a3:1
  • value  577825461
    address  3GEKtzPMko9j25BUgoZ1da1nFXyGvUJZsf